One of the roles that robotic process automation (RPA) plays in customer service is the automation of repetitive operations through the use of software robots. These jobs include data entry, form processing, and email handling. Robotic process automation (RPA) has the ability to handle common inquiries in customer care, allowing human agents to focus on more complicated issues. For instance, a robotic process automation (RPA) bot can automatically react to frequently asked questions from customers, change information about customers in databases, and handle service requests.

Robotic Process Automation (RPA) is one the powerful approach nowadays this is playing an important role to transform the business it offers the variety of range of fetairs that we make it more powerful tool and make it to stand out in the market RPA is designed to work with existing IT systems without requiring deep integration or major changes to the infrastructure. Unlike traditional automation solutions that may require APIs or backend integration, RPA interacts with applications just like a human user would—through the user interface. This means:
- No need to alter the core systems.
- Reduced implementation time and cost.
- Compatibility with a wide range of legacy systems, desktop applications, and web-based platforms.
This non-intrusive nature allows organizations to adopt RPA without risking disruption to their day-to-day operations or existing IT investments.

3. Accuracy
Robotic Process Automation leads to accuracy, it leads to how we are doing the task efficiently. RPA bots execute tasks with high precision and consistency. Unlike humans, who are prone to fatigue and error, especially with monotonous tasks, RPA bots:
- Follow predefined rules and logic strictly.
- Eliminate errors caused by manual entry or oversight.
- Improve the overall quality and reliability of data.
This ensures that critical business processes run smoothly and without interruption due to human error.
4. Compliance and Auditability
Nowadays, we all have mainly joined the latest technologies, like when we enter the office, there is an automatic time stamp that you have seen that is also a part of Robotic Process Automation RPA offers built-in features for compliance and auditability, making it easier for organizations to meet regulatory and policy requirements. Every action performed by a bot is:
- Logged and time-stamped.
- Traceable for future reference.
- Available for audit trails and reporting.
This transparency ensures that businesses can maintain oversight and demonstrate compliance with industry standards, internal policies, or government regulations.

1. Identify the Right Processes
The first aim leads to identify the best process of Robotic Process Automation as per our need of business it nt about we are just suing andwastting our money it is about which planning we are ding for our growth and with which automated tool that si supported by Robotic Process Automation The foundation of successful RPA implementation lies in selecting the right processes to automate. Not every task is suitable for automation, so organizations should focus on:
Rule-Based Processes: Tasks that follow a clear set of rules and decisions. It means our goal must be clear and satisfactory
- Repetitive Tasks: Processes that are carried out frequently with minimal variation.
- High-Volume Transactions: Tasks that are performed in large quantities, like data entry or invoice processing. If we are spending money on this or investing our time in Robotic Process Automation technology then at that time, there must bea heavy workload so that we can fully utilize this tool
- Low Exception Rates: Processes with fewer deviations or anomalies are ideal for initial automation.
Examples include payroll processing, data migration, customer onboarding, and order fulfillment. Conducting a thorough process assessment ensures that RPA delivers maximum value from the start.

Before going live, conduct a pilot project in a controlled environment. This phase helps to:
- Validate the tool and process selection.
- Identify potential technical or operational challenges.
- Test the effectiveness of automation in a real-world scenario.
- Measure initial ROI and success metrics.
The pilot should involve key stakeholders—including IT, operations, and process owners—to ensure alignment and gather feedback for refinement.

GenAI with RPA
Generative artificial intelligence (AI) is a technology that enhances robotic process automation (RPA) by enabling machines to comprehend and generate text that is similar to that produced by humans. This feature is especially helpful in situations involving customer service, where it is essential to provide responses that are both customized and aware of the environment.
When businesses combine RPA and generative artificial intelligence, they can automate the management of increasingly complicated interactions with customers. Utilizing Generative AI, for instance, enables an RPA bot to develop a response that is both detailed and contextually suitable when it is confronted with a customer query that is particularly difficult to understand.
